One surname that is particularly intriguing is "Gikonyo." This surname has a rich history and is found in various parts of the world, making it a compelling subject for exploration.
The surname Gikonyo is of African origin, specifically from Kenya. In Kikuyu, one of the languages spoken in Kenya, "Gikonyo" is a male name that means "one who beats the drum." It is a name that is deeply rooted in the cultural traditions of the Kikuyu people, reflecting their heritage and values.
Over time, "Gikonyo" evolved from being a personal name to a surname, indicating lineage or family association. This transformation is common in many cultures, where personal names become surnames as they are passed down through generations.
Despite its African origins, the surname Gikonyo has spread beyond the borders of Kenya and can be found in various countries around the world. According to data, the highest incidence of the surname is in Kenya, where it is most commonly used. However, there are also significant numbers of individuals with the surname Gikonyo in the United States, the United Arab Emirates, Antigua and Barbuda, England, Botswana, Sudan, Norway, Australia, Tanzania, Brazil, Congo, Switzerland, Spain, Iraq, Oman, Rwanda, Sweden, and Uganda.
Each of these countries has a small but notable population of individuals with the surname Gikonyo, indicating that this name has traveled far from its African origins.
